Learning Object Attributes with Category-Free Grounded Language from Deep Featurization

Luke E. Richards, Kasra Darvish, Cynthia Matuszek

Abstract

While grounded language learning, or learning the meaning of language with respect to the physical world in which a robot operates, is a major area in human-robot interaction studies, most research occurs in closed worlds or domain-constrained settings. We present a system in which language is grounded in visual percepts without using categorical constraints by combining CNN-based visual featurization with natural language labels. We demonstrate results comparable to those achieved using handcrafted features for specific traits, a step towards moving language grounding into the space of fully open world recognition.
